I really enjoyed doing the scrapbook page and was a bit nervous at first, I didn't want to ruin it. Thanks for everyone's comments. I originally finished it but thought the bottom left hand corner looked a little bare, then I remembered I had the pack of little ant stickers (only 35p) so I thought they would fit in.
Rustyflange - the paper was from a designer called Karen Foster, the fern paper on the card is by her too. She does some fantastic designs for kids. I ordered the papers from here: http://www.atripdownmemorylane.co.uk/catalog/index.php?manufacturers_id=47&osCsid=7a69d3ea3c97a3477b5e1e9de77cfd3d
The stickers are about about 1.50 - 2.00 a pack, but I found a seller on ebay who's really helpful and she has a lot of Karen Foster stickers for 99p -
http://stores.ebay.co.uk/Magpie-Cards-and-Crafts_KAREN-FOSTER-DESIGN_W0QQcolZ4QQdirZ1QQfsubZ218952016QQftidZ2QQtZkm
the stickers are really nice, they're cardstock stickers so are really easy to use.
I love the "my brave knight" range and the "outer space" papers and stickers. I spent hours looking for her products and these places seemed to have the best and cheapest selection, HTH.0 -
